Huh what? Other than a few small changes, the rules for Arcana in the RC (pp.133-136) are identical to the rules for Arcana in the PHB (pp.181-182).
- Arcana Knowledge: Identical.
 
- Monster Knowledge: Identical except for DCs.
 
- Identify Conjuration or Zone: Identical except for DCs.
 
- Identify Ritual / Identify Magical Effect: Combined into a single "Identify Magical Phenomenon" block in the RC. RC also says you understand the effect/ritual's basic purpose and effects, which the PHB doesn't, but this is arguably just a better phrasing of RAI. Otherwise, they're identical except for DCs.
 
- Sense the Presence of Magic: Identical except for DCs and duration (reduced from 1 minute to standard action).
